About the Author
As fate would have a say in the molding of a colorful writer, Helena Cray was born in the diverse city of Calcutta, India and grew up under the influence of the teachings of the Dalai Lama and the romance and mysticism of the Himalayas, the Taj Mahal and the Sunderbands, home of the Royal Bengal Tiger. She spent most of her days soul searching, writing poetry and some short stories until her adult years took her on her journeys far and wide from Iran, crossing boundaries and borders she once dreamed of, to Greece and Italy where the seeds of her book was planted. Inspired by the greatness of King Cyrus and where Alexander the Great once coveted to conquer the Ottoman Empire, she sought the magic of the pen and put her inspiration on paper. Born to parents of Indian descent, raised by a motivating step father, Helena grew up in a boarding school; upon graduating she began her travels. She lived in Iran for many years. She witnessed the Iran hostage crisis and the revolution then she fled to the USA where she found refuge and freedom, not just from a country at war but also from the chains of human bondage.
